  2. 2. Rigidity of the Doubly-Magic 100Sn Core

    Författare :Matej Lipoglavsek; Partikel- och kärnfysik; []
    Nyckelord :NATURVETENSKAP; NATURAL SCIENCES; in-beam gamma-ray spectrscopy; nuclear structure; fusion-evaporation reactions; nuclear shell model; quadrupole polarization charge; doubly-magic nucleus; Nuclear physics; Kärnfysik; Fysicumarkivet A:1998:Lipoglavšek;

    Sammanfattning : The doubly magic nucleus 100Sn represents a crucial test for the nuclear shell model, which is a widely used model for a quantitative description of nuclei. Excited states in 100Sn are experimentally not accessible with present day techniques, but it is possible to gain insight into its structure by studying the properties of excited states of neighboring nuclei.   3. 3. Nuclear Structure and Exotic Decays; Doubly-Magic 56Ni and Semi-Magic 58Ni

    Författare :Emma Johansson; Kärnfysik; []
    Nyckelord :NATURVETENSKAP; NATURAL SCIENCES; Doubly magic; semi magic; 56Ni; 58Ni; high-spin states; fusion-evaporation reactions; cranked Nilsson-Strutinsky calculations; shell-model calculations; prompt proton decay; prompt alpha decay;

    Sammanfattning : The nuclear structure of two nuclei, 56Ni and 58Ni, has been studied using fusion-evaporation reaction experiments. The experiments were performed at the Lawrence Berkeley and Argonne National Laboratories in the U.S.A. LÄS MER
